Has anyone changed the way that Epicor decides what order to allocate
orders to bins? We have been using the bin ascending rule, but our bins
are labeled by aisle-shelf-bin, which does not map very well to a preferred
pick location.
We would like to use something like zones to define the allocation
hierarchy, but this would apparently mean adding a customization to enforce
this preference. Has anyone done something like this? Are we missing
something in the built-in functionality?
